Cacti and succulents are a perfect option for those looking to add a touch of exoticism and resilience to their gardens or indoor spaces. Known for their unique adaptations to arid climates, these plants are able to store water in their leaves, stems, or roots, allowing them to survive prolonged drought conditions. With their geometric shapes and wide variety of sizes and colors, cacti and succulents bring a modern, minimalist aesthetic to any setting. They are ideal for low-maintenance gardens, sunny patios, terraces, and even interiors, where their resilience and decorative beauty stand out in spaces of all kinds. Plus, these plants are perfect for beginners, as they require little care: sporadic watering, plenty of light, and a well-drained substrate are all they need to thrive. Whether as solitary plants or forming creative combinations in planters, cacti and succulents bring a unique and natural character to any space.
